If breast cancer is detected What is the first treatment step?

after self detection of breast lumps Or it may be detected by screening by mammograms. The patient must be examined to confirm the diagnosis by taking a biopsy for examination. to confirm that such a lump was found Breast cancer cells. Then the doctor will diagnose at what stage the breast cancer is. which can be divided into 3 phases as follows:

  • initial stage : The disease is mainly in the breast area. can perform surgical treatment and has a very high chance of being cured
  • invasive period : The disease has spread to nearby lymph nodes. Treatment can be more complicated. Treatment may be with medication, surgery, and radiation.
  • spread distance : The disease has spread to other organs outside the mammary glands. Drug treatment is mainly used.

Usually, the treatment will depend on the nature of the biopsy. And the stage of breast cancer is important, for example, in the early stages. Treatment can be primarily done by surgery. And there may be other treatments such as chemotherapy. anti-hormonal medication targeted drug delivery or light irradiation to reduce the chance of breast cancer recurrence Moreover, many types of breast cancer surgery are now available. whether it is treated by surgery for the whole breast Breast preservation surgery or surgery and breast augmentation at the same time In order to maintain the image of beauty, which is important to the mind.

What is the removal surgery?

It is important to have surgery to remove the cancer completely. Not even a small cell was left. The tumor size may be millimeters in size. up to several centimeters in size If diagnosed by screening Most cancerous tumors are small. which can be easily cured by surgery Most cancerous tumors are quite large. This may complicate the treatment.

In which cases should the treatment be done by removing the breast?

If the tumor is still small and has not spread to the lymph nodes The surgeon will then be able to perform breast conserving surgery. But if the cancer is large or has spread to nearby lymph nodes will have to give chemotherapy first to make the lumps smaller and make it easier for the surgeon to perform the surgery or even breast-preserving surgery can be performed. But in some patients there may be other limitations. who are unable to perform breast preservation surgery It is necessary to remove the whole breast, depending on the doctor’s consideration primarily.

after surgery Is there any further treatment needed?

After undergoing surgery The doctor will have to analyze the nature of the cancer that has been surgically removed. that the patient What additional treatments are necessary, such as the need for chemotherapy? Anti-hormonal drugs, targeted drugs, or radiation? which must be considered individually This is because doctors need to look at many factors, including the nature of the cancer, the patient’s age, and physical health conditions. and congenital disease in order to determine which patients are suitable for which complementary treatment

cancer cells spread How can the treatment be done?

For cases where the disease has spread locally such as a large cancerous lump or spread to nearby lymph nodes quite a lot Treatment may be more complicated. Your doctor will need to assess which form of treatment should be given. or whichever method first, for example, if the tumor is very large Medications may be given to make the tumor smaller first. and then perform surgery, etc.

Next, if the cancer has spread to other organs Treatment may not be able to cure the disease itself. But the treatment aims to allow the patient to alleviate the symptoms of the disease. and can have a quality of life as close to normal as possible There are many methods of treatment, such as the use of chemotherapy drugs. Anti-hormonal drugs, targeted drugs, radiation, depends on the doctor’s determination of which treatment is most appropriate at that time.

breast cancer treatment process How long does it take?

At present, there are many different treatment approaches. The treatment time varies from person to person. and stage of disease It depends on what kind of treatment each patient needs, such as early stage breast cancer. after surgery If the patient needs to continue treatment by using chemotherapy. It takes 3-6 months for the drug to be administered, after which radiation therapy is necessary. It must take another 1-2 months of exposure, and if necessary, anti-hormonal drugs. have to take the drug for another 5 years, etc.

After treatment, how will the disease be monitored? Is there any chance of recurrence?

The doctor will schedule follow-up appointments for at least about 5 years, after which they may schedule a distant visit, eg once a year, as the disease may recur at any time. Patients need to keep an eye on their symptoms at all times. whether there are any abnormal symptoms, such as feeling a lump in the breast, armpit, or feeling tired, breathless, coughing, pain in the body, bone, limb weakness, or any abnormality due to these symptoms It can be a sign of cancer recurrence and a symptom of the cancer spreading to other organs.
